Post by Daddy_Tiger »

The PVC has been slowly dying for a while now. I really don't see anyway to save it at this point. You might prolong it a few years, but it's going to die soon.

It was a very good league at one point, but it is long past that now.

Buckeye Trail would have to leave the OVAC to play the IVC schedule. It wouldn't qualify for anything even if it tried to stay because of the minimum games required.

Barnesville has always made some sense, but there isn't much if anything for them to gain by joining.

All teams left are already in the OVAC and will likely still play each other, so I don't think it will really matter all that much as far as scheduling goes.

Hard to swallow for us "old timers" who played in some terrific games and rivalries. I saw many gyms filled to capacity with chairs on the baselines to see some great teams play.
